Boguszów-Gorce weather in July

In July, Boguszów-Gorce sees average daytime highs of 22°C and overnight lows near 12°C, with 118 mm of rain across 15.8 wet days and about 15.8 hours of daylight. It is the 1st-warmest and 1st-wettest month of the year here.

Highs climb over the month, from about 21°C in the first days to 22°C by the end.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 21% of the time in July, and the air most often feels dry.

Daylight stretches from about 16 h 12 min at the start of July to 15 h 12 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, July is Boguszów-Gorce's 2nd-clearest and 11th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Boguszów-Gorce's year-round climate.

Location & terrain

Where is Boguszów-Gorce?

Boguszów-Gorce sits at 50.8°N, 16.2°E, 581 m above sea level, in Poland. The nearest listed city is Wałbrzych, 6.0 km away.

Topography around Boguszów-Gorce

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Boguszów-Gorce.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Boguszów-Gorce has signific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 414 m around an average of 576 m above sea level; within 16 km, large vari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 664 m; within 80 km, very signific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 1,502 m.

The land around Boguszów-Gorce is covered by trees (63%) and grassland (28%) within 3 km, trees (51%) and grassland (29%) within 16 km, and cropland (41%) and trees (40%) within 80 km.
